Helen "Yelena" Ward, cherished mother, beloved grandmother, and dear friend, passed away on December 3, 2025, in Troy, Michigan, at the age of 88. Born on September 12, 1937, in Detroit, Michigan, she led a life full of warmth, love, and connection, leaving an indelible mark on everyone fortunate enough to know her.
Helen dedicated nearly 40 years of her life to Roney Investments Brokerage Firm, from which she retired in 1998. Her career was characterized by dedication, hard work, and a steadfast commitment to those around her. She was a model of professionalism and courtesy, proving to be a sincere and dependable colleague to many.
Education was also important to Helen, as she graduated from Pershing High School in Detroit. Starting with her 25th reunion and continuing for decades, she played a key role in organizing class reunions, fostering lifelong friendships and connections among her classmates up until their 70th milestone.
Helen was immensely proud of her family. She leaves behind her son, James (Susan) Ward, and her granddaughter, Loralyn (Al) Flick, whom she adored. A beacon of positivity and affection, Helen's greatest wish was to celebrate her granddaughter's wedding, a moment that brought her immense joy and allowed her to dance her heart out, surrounded by loved ones. The value she placed on her family and friends was a defining characteristic. She shared countless fond memories, particularly those spent annually celebrating Thanksgiving week at their cherished cabin in Northern Michigan—an enduring tradition that lasted over 50 years.
Those who had the privilege of knowing Helen often describe her as friendly, sociable, and approachable. Her life was a tapestry of experiences, filled with numerous places visited and cultures tasted, particularly through her love of baking, cooking, and savoring diverse cuisines. She approached life with a positive attitude and pure enthusiasm, embodying the essence of friendship and fellowship.
Nevertheless, Helen faced significant challenges in her later years, bravely contending with serious health issues, including a brain tumor and breast cancer, fighting tirelessly for more than three years. Her strength, resilience, and optimistic spirit are truly admirable. Helen’s fight was extraordinary, and she faced adversity with grace and dignity until the end, when the tumor became unmanageable.
Helen is reunited in eternal rest with her beloved husband, Ernie Ward, her son, John Ward, and her brother, James Lisull, all of whom she deeply missed. Her legacy of love, perseverance, and joy lives on through her surviving family members and the countless friends whose lives she touched.
Visitation will be held on December 9, 2025, from 3:00 PM to 7:00 PM, followed by a funeral service beginning at 7:00 PM, at Wysocki & Wilk Funeral Home, 29440 Ryan Rd, Warren, MI 48092.
As we gather to celebrate the life of Helen "Yelena" Ward, let us remember her unwavering love for family and friends, her joyful spirit, and her inspiring ability to create cherished memories that will endure in our hearts forever.
Donations in Helen's memory can be made to Residential Hospice.
